What Is the Doom of Dimensions Box?
The Yu-Gi-Oh! OCG Doom of Dimensions is an official booster set by Konami Japan. It launched on July 26, 2025, following Duelist’s Advance as the second entry in Series 13. Furthermore, it connects directly to the promotional animated shorts series Yu-Gi-Oh! CARD Game: The Chronicles, which began airing in April of the same year.
The Japanese OCG edition includes:
- 30 packs per box
- 5 cards per pack (150 cards total)
- 80 cards in the base set (125 in the Master Set)
- 4 Ultimate Rares, 8 Ultra Rares, 10 Super Rares, 18 Rares, 44 Commons
- 20 cards also available as Secret Rare
- 20 cards also available as Prismatic Secret Rare
- +1 Assist Pack included with every first-print box
What’s New in Doom of Dimensions?
Two Brand-New Archetypes
This set introduces two entirely new archetypes to the OCG. First, DoomZ — a theme built around DARK Dragon Effect Monsters and WIND Machine Xyz Monsters. Its boss monster, DoomZ XII End – Drastrius, comes at Secret Rare and Prismatic Secret Rare. Consequently, it stands as one of the most sought-after pulls in the entire box.
In addition, the set introduces the Radiant Typhoon archetype. It connects directly to the iconic Mystical Space Typhoon spell — a card with over twenty years of history in the game. Moreover, each Radiant Typhoon monster takes its name from a mythological figure tied to storms and elemental forces. This gives the archetype a strong identity that sets it apart from anything currently in the format.
First-Ever Doom King Support
Beyond the new archetypes, this set delivers the first official Doom King support in OCG/TCG history. Konami has never printed these cards before. Therefore, longtime fans of the game will find this one of the most significant moments this set has to offer.
Support for Fan-Favorite Decks
Doom of Dimensions also brings new cards for a wide range of established strategies. These include D/D, D/D/D, Dark Contract, Tri-Brigade, Dogmatika, Solfachord, Megalith, Dinowrestler, Gagaga, Gogogo, Dododo, Zubaba, and more. As a result, players waiting for new tools for these decks will find plenty to work with inside a single box.
Why the Japanese OCG Edition Specifically?
The Japanese OCG edition differs from the TCG version in several key ways. First, the OCG box structure offers 30 packs of 5 cards. The TCG, by contrast, gives you 24 packs of 9. Furthermore, the OCG includes Ultimate Rares — a foil treatment the TCG version does not offer. This makes Japanese boxes uniquely desirable for collectors who value premium card presentation.
In addition, first-print Japanese boxes include the +1 Assist Pack. This bonus reprints key cards for building decks around the set’s main themes. Because of this, sealed Japanese boxes hold strong appeal on the secondary market well after a set’s initial release.
